I did a search on all forums using the keywords shown in Title and found ZERO listings!!! Have To Say I Am Shocked. I have a 2014 Bennington SL21 with a Yeasu 90hp 4 stroke engine unfortunately I tried to take the boat out today only the 5th time this season and after starting engine we I heard a high pitch siren whistle warning noise. I thought perhaps it was the impeller but I noticed there was oil dripping from the engine. I turned the motor off and raised the engine thinking the motor was hit by someone while docked, unfortunately as I raised engine the leaking increased significantly. I lowered motor and leaking came to a stop with engine off. After doing some research I feel the Oil Seals may be the problem. Strange thing is engine only has 145 hours on it. Is it normal that this needs to be changed so soon and should I contact Yamaha once I take it to new dealer as I no longer use the original dealer.
THOUGHTS ??
